Fundamental Concepts of Inorganic Chemistry (Volume 1) by Dr. Asim K. Das is a comprehensive textbook widely used by undergraduate and postgraduate chemistry students to build a strong theoretical foundation. Published by CBS Publishers & Distributors, this volume is the first in a multi-part series designed to cover the breadth of inorganic chemistry. Key Content & Topics

Volume 1 focuses on the core principles of atomic structure and nuclear chemistry. Major sections include:

Atomic Structure: Detailed exploration of wave mechanics and quantum chemistry principles. Asim K Das Inorganic Chemistry Pdf Vol 1

Nuclear Chemistry: Coverage of nuclear structure, reactions, and nuclear energy.

Radiation Chemistry: Principles and applications of radioactive processes.

Nucleosynthesis: The origin and formation of elements in the universe.

Chemical Periodicity: Systematic study of the periodic trends of elements. Book Features

Academic Rigor: The text is tailored for B.Sc. (Honours) and M.Sc. students, aligning with standard university curricula.

Pedagogical Tools: Each chapter includes meticulously prepared exercises and problems to reinforce understanding.

Author Profile: Dr. Asim K. Das is a Professor of Chemistry at Visva-Bharati University, with extensive research experience in inorganic reaction mechanisms. Availability

Content and Structure: A Deep Dive into Fundamentals

Volume 1 of Das’s Inorganic Chemistry is not an overview; it is a methodical, rigorous exploration of the discipline’s core theoretical principles. The book is strategically divided into major sections that build a robust foundation.

  1. Atomic Structure and Periodic Properties: The text begins with a detailed, quantum-mechanical view of the atom, moving beyond simple Bohr models to discuss wave functions, quantum numbers, and electronic configurations. It then meticulously connects these concepts to periodic trends—ionization energy, electron affinity, electronegativity, and atomic radii—using clear graphs and explanatory tables.

The Chemistry of s- and p-Block Elements: Unlike many Western texts that integrate descriptive chemistry throughout, Das dedicates the latter half of Volume 1 to the systematic study of main group elements. Each group (alkali metals to noble gases) is examined through the lens of preparation, properties, trends in reactivity, and key compounds. The discussion of anomalous behavior of the first element in each group (e.g., lithium, beryllium) is particularly detailed and exam-relevant.

  4. Foundations of Coordination Chemistry: Volume 1 concludes with an introduction to coordination compounds, covering nomenclature, isomerism, and Werner’s theory, setting the stage for the more advanced treatments (crystal field and ligand field theories) typically found in Volume 2.
